About this role

Join Whistle as a Business Development Representative to sell HRTech and Employee Benefits to USA clients, driving growth through strategic outreach.

About the Company

Whistle partners with innovative B2B tech companies to help them scale through effective lead generation and outreach.

Key Highlights

  • Focus on selling HRTech and Employee Benefits.
  • Opportunity to work with leading B2B tech companies.
  • High-growth environment with a strategic outreach approach.
  • Remote work not available, based in Cape Town.
